Islands focus: Police to deploy 3,800 personnel for Waisak

The Central Java Police will deploy 3,800 officers to guard Buddhist celebrations for Waisak Day on Saturday, which will be centered at the iconic Borobudur Temple in Magelang, Central Java

he Central Java Police will deploy 3,800 officers to guard Buddhist celebrations for Waisak Day on Saturday, which will be centered at the iconic Borobudur Temple in Magelang, Central Java.

Aside from mobile brigade personnel, counterterrorism officers from Densus 88 will also be deployed.

“Personnel will be on guard from Friday until Monday. It’s one of the most important events of the year,” Central Java Police chief Insp. Gen. Condro Kirono said on Friday.

Vice President Jusuf Kalla is slated to attend the event late on Saturday.

The police have also cleared nearby night entertainment spots and street vendors to ensure order during the annual event.

Meanwhile, dozens of Buddhist monks have prepared for the ritual by collecting holy water from Umbul Jumprit River in Temanggung, Central Java.

The water will be transported to Borobudur for the Waisak celebration that will culminate early on Sunday.

The celebration will also be attended by 13 Buddhist monks from Thailand.
